Need help from DUers with car repair knowledge.
Started my car yesterday and heard a loud whine from under the hood. Raised the hood and it seemed that that the noise only happened when the A/C compressor was engaged. Went back in the car and felt the air coming from the vents. It was fairly cold. Turned off the A/C, and the noise stopped and the air from the vents got warmer, as expected.

I've not used the A/C again except to run a pressure test on the low side port. It was reading at 20 with the A/C on max. I havent heard the noise with the A/C off.

I'm going to leave further diagnosis and repair to a pro, but of course don't want to get tricked into unneeded service. Does this sound like it needs a new compressor, a simple recharge, or something in between? The more I know going in the better chance I have of an honest repair.
